Hacienda-Inspired All-Inclusive Resort with Oceanfront Pools

Although there are many resort towns along Mexico's Pacific coast, Puerto Vallarta has a bit more history than most of them. Old Vallarta is lined with cobblestone streets, bougainvillea-draped villas, and a 1920s cathedral topped with a sculpture of a crown. The romantic setting helped earn the city the top spot among Mexican destinations in TripAdvisor's Travelers' Choice 2012 awards.

Today, the city has expanded to the north, which features a hotel zone lined with luxury high-rises. This is where you'll find the all-inclusive Krystal Hotel & Beach Resort Vallarta, whose hacienda-inspired architecture includes stucco façades, rustic archways, and wooden pergolas. More than 40 old-fashioned fountains feature on the 25-acre beachfront property. One of these, a re-created aqueduct, trickles through the gardens alongside standard rooms.

Each day, the resort's entertainment staff leads poolside activities such as bingo and karaoke. Kids can find plenty more to do at Kamp Krystal (open 9 a.m.–5 p.m. daily), from painting figurines to earning their scuba-diving certification in a ball pit. Meanwhile, adults can visit the Millennium Spa, whose saunas are accented with aromatherapy fragrances.

Buffets run continuously from 8 a.m. to 11 p.m. at Las Velas, an international eatery overlooking Banderas Bay, but the dining options don't end there. You can sit down for a formal meal of Italian cuisine at La Cinque Terre or sushi at Kamakura.

Puerto Vallarta, Mexico: Tropical Paradise with Cosmopolitan Flair

Puerto Vallarta is among Mexico’s most sophisticated cities, with trendy restaurants and bustling beaches such as Playa los Muertos, a popular stretch of golden sand dotted with fishermen and beach-volleyball players. Nearby, a 10-block boardwalk known as the malecón offers unobstructed ocean views as it extends from the city center, past fountains and a famous 9-foot-high statue of a boy riding a seahorse.

Called “the most gay-friendly city in Mexico” by Frommer’s, Vallarta draws a diverse crowd of vacationers intent on relaxing during the day and living it up at night, bouncing between the city’s numerous dance clubs and bouncy castles. For a glimpse of the city's history, head to Old Vallarta, where artists peddle shawls and piñatas, and mariachi bands serenade couples dancing on Plaza Principal.
